Skip to content
| Marketplace
Sign in
Visual Studio>Controls>IronPDF - C# .NET PDF Library
IronPDF - C# .NET PDF Library

IronPDF - C# .NET PDF Library

Iron-Software

|
1,907 clicks
| (1) | Free Trial
IronPDF is a HTML to PDF Library for .NET. It works with HTML, JS, CSS, & images - making the most of your web skills. IronPDF uses a Chrome Rendering Engine to produce pixel-perfect PDFs.
Get Started

IronPDF: All in one .NET C# PDF Library to Create PDFs from HTML

features-table.png

With its expanding userbase, growing feature portfolio, and a laser-sharp focus on developer success, Iron has built IronPDF as a straightforward and scalable .NET library that lets you not only create PDF documents, but edit, export, secure, load, and manipulate as well – in short, everything an ideal PDF editor needs and more.

How is IronPDF an Ideal PDF Creator and Editor?

We begin with a Chrome-based rendering engine that removes the need for installation, makes our design functional, and enables smooth content deployment – allowing us to give you a precise C# HTML to PDF converter.

If you, as a developer, focus on productivity and quality, so do we.

This is why IronPDF’s extensive features let you create responsive PDF files through multiple methods:

  • HTML Strings and Templates – create PDF documents from HTML 4 and 5, CSS, and JavaScript
  • ASPX WebForms – convert, with 3 lines of code, ASP.NET webforms to downloadable PDFs viewable in the browser
  • MVC Views – export ASP.NET MVC views as PDF
  • HTML Documents – convert HTML forms to PDF forms
  • From URLs – generate PDF documents from URLs
  • Image to PDF – convert, with a single line code, JPG, PNG, GIF, BMP, TIFF, system drawing, and SVG to PDF

IronPDF removes your suffering and provides an out of the box PDF creator and editor in one.

Just as you can convert from different formats to high-quality PDF files, IronPDF lets you:

  • Read and fill form data
  • Extract images and text data from PDFs

Our functionalities do not end there!

To edit, and manipulate your PDF documents, IronPDF excels at allowing you to:

  • Generating PDFs from: HTML, URL, JavaScript, CSS and many image formats
  • Adding headers/footers, signatures, attachments, and passwords and security
  • Performance optimization: Full Multihreading and Async support
  • And many more! Visit our website to see all our code examples and a full list of our 50+ features

End-to-end Conversion Support

In addition to the above, our extensive HTML to PDF support includes:

  • Mainstream icon fonts (Fontello, Bootstrap, FontAwesome)
  • Loading external stylesheets and assets (HTTP, HTTPS, or filesystem) programmatically
  • Static and multithread rendering
  • Load URLs with custom network login credentials, UserAgents, Proxies, Cookies, HTTP headers, form variables allowing login behind HTML login forms
  • Custom ‘base URL’ to allow accessible asset files across the web
  • Responsive layouts through Virtual View port (Width and Height)
  • Custom ISO paper size with customizable orientations, margins, and color
  • Custom zoom with scalable:
  • HTML content to dimensions that preserves the quality
  • Output resolution in DPI
  • Embed System Drawing image assets into HTML strings with ImagetoDataURI
  • Enable Javascript support including optional Render delays
  • Screen or Print CSS media types
  • Accept HTML encoded in any major file encoding (Default to UTF-8)

Save it! Secure it! Print it!

Secure your PDFs by updating user passwords, metadata, security permissions, and verifiable digital signatures. The digital signatures are not just limited to converted hand signatures, rather you can assign any asset from images, location, metadata, contact information, and timestamps.

Once you secure your document; save and load from Files, Binary Data, or MemoryStreams.

Even better, turn any PDF into a PrintDocument object and send it to your printer without Adobe – with just a few lines of code.

Edit on the Fly

Did you just save your PDF document and want to edit it or edit an imported PDF?

With IronPDF, you can load your PDF file, and:

  • Add, edit, update outlines and bookmarks, program annotations with sticky notes
  • Add foreground or background overlays from HTML or PDF assets
  • Stamp new HTML Content onto any existing PDF page
  • Add logical or HTML headers and footers

It is that simple!

No Compatibility Issues

IronPDF allows you to transition into limitless framework compatibilities with:

  • .NET 6 and .NET 5
  • .NET Framework 4.0 and above (Windows and Azure)
  • .NET Core 2.0 and above (MacOS, Linux, Windows. Includes support for cloud hosting including AWS and Azure)
  • .NET Standard 2.0 and above (MacOS, Linux, Windows. Includes support for cloud hosting including AWS and Azure)

Move Ahead with IronPDF

Visit our official site ironpdf

Please visit this link dll download to learn more about IronPDF.

With a plethora of features that IronPDF has to offer, you can use C# to create PDFs right away by heading over to our Nuget Install page - whether you would like to create a simple text fragment or dynamic business reports, our individual and commercial licenses benefit from a lifetime licenses and provide you with a 30-day money-back guarantee!

iron_trusted_by.png

  • Contact us
  • Jobs
  • Privacy
  • Manage cookies
  • Terms of use
  • Trademarks
© 2025 Microsoft